Start with a Plan
Before you start buying furniture and plants, it’s important to have a plan for your outdoor living space. Beautiful and Affordable Backyard Consider what you want to use the space for – will it be a place for entertaining, relaxing, or gardening? Once you’ve identified your goals, create a rough sketch of your backyard and decide where you want to place key elements like a seating area, a dining area, and a garden. Beautiful and Affordable Backyard this will help you make the most of your space and avoid costly mistakes.
Choose the Right Furniture
When it comes to outdoor furniture, it’s important to choose pieces that are both durable and affordable. Look for materials like resin wicker, aluminum, or teak, which are all weather-resistant and long-lasting. You can also find great deals on outdoor furniture at end-of-season sales or by shopping second-hand.
Create Shade
If your outdoor living space gets a lot of sun, it’s important to create shade to protect yourself and your furniture from the elements. One budget-friendly option is to install a retractable awning or a shade sail, which can be easily removed during the off-season.
Add Greenery
Adding plants to your outdoor living space can help create a sense of tranquility and beauty. Look for low-maintenance plants like succulents or native plants that thrive in your region. You can also create a vertical garden using recycled pallets or planters to save space and add visual interest.
Use Lighting
Adding lighting to your outdoor living space can create a cozy and inviting atmosphere. Look for affordable options like string lights, lanterns, or solar-powered lights, which require no electrical installation.
DIY Your Decor
Instead of spending a lot of money on outdoor decor, consider making your own. You can create DIY garden art, like painted rocks or mosaic stepping stones, or repurpose old furniture by giving it a fresh coat of paint.
Install a Fire Pit
A fire pit can be a great focal point for your outdoor living space, and it’s an affordable way to extend your outdoor season into the fall. You can build a DIY fire pit using bricks or pavers, or purchase a portable fire pit that can be easily moved around.
Repurpose Old Items
Before you throw away old items like an old bicycle or an antique dresser, consider repurposing them for your outdoor living space. An old bicycle can become a unique planter, while an antique dresser can be converted into an outdoor bar or storage unit.
Create a Focal Point
Creating a focal point in your outdoor living space can help draw the eye and make the space feel more cohesive. Consider adding a water feature, like a small fountain or a pond, or creating a focal point using a piece of art or a sculpture.
Shop Smart
When it comes to creating an outdoor living space on a budget, it’s important to shop smart. Look for deals at end-of-season sales, check out clearance racks, and consider shopping at discount retailers. You can also save money by purchasing in bulk, such as buying a large quantity of pavers or plants at once.
